I'm not sure where to begin really...
Our trek to our east side family was WAY in the middle of NOWHERE today! When we finally determined that we were at our destination, we were met by a very nice family. As we told this gal what we were doing there, I thought maybe I was speaking a foreign language at first. The look on her face made me studder a bit and start trying to explain our intentions again! As I began to spill out to her a second time what we were doing there, Eman kinda stepped in and, the look of elation and relief came over her. I was really at a loss for a moment there. I think it was disbelief. As we did last year, we started by presenting Eman's should-be-famous meal. From there, we explained that all of the items(with the exception of a 3 phase motor) in the back of my truck were for her. She must have asked half a dozen times how we had managed to find out all of these things about her! Every time, our response was that we were crafty! LOL! This morning, I wrapped several items for Grandma and a couple for Grandaughter but, most were too large to wrap. I wanted them to have something for under the tree. Being how their new trailer isn't set yet, most of what I brought to them today, came back with me to be stored in my conference room until their new home is ready to move into. We were asked to tell each and every one of you thank you and so, THANK YOU! This year, we were met on both sides with a unique situation...We had a surplus of funds! We also, almost immediately had a solution to this! After I got the call yesterday that the west had a surplus, I got another call about a family in need. As per the request of the insurance salesman, I won't mention his name(wink wink!). He had a family that Grandma and Grandpa was raising twin 7 yr olds who really wanted some new bicycles to ride. The anonymous insurance salesman made it happen! On top of that, he was able to provide numerous gift cards to help them along the way with groceries and...Life! I think it's safe to say that the experience was a humbling one for them as well. After I sat down today, and totalled up reciepts, I determined that we had $208.56 left over from the east side family. Well, sadly, last night, in a nearby town, a trailer fire occurred. In that trailer was four children. Two boys, ages 4 and 6, didn't make it out alive. Two girls, ages 10 and 12 did. Not only did they lose two young lives, they lost everything they owned, including Christmas presents. I called "Chicken" and explained the situtation and, immediately, he said, "Cut em the check!" So, that's what happened. I'm not sure if the money will go toward funeral cost or replacing clothes and toys but, I'm certain it will go to good use! I am again humbled by the fact that I am surrounded by so many great people here at SC! You guys don't know how far-reaching your contributions have gone! It's an unbelievable experience to be a part of and, I can't thank each of you enough for helping make it happen!! Without each of you, this is impossible. I am quite certain that I am forgetting some details and, I know that there are some of you who have offered items/appliances to us for this event...Know that we are coming for them very soon. We ran out of time but, will be along soon to pick up the rest. May The Good Lord continue to bless each of you as he has blessed me. Again, my hat is off to you. You guys/gals are the greatest!!
